Output d5953fc9adae9411bc6937e4542ca1b661fff65420c5468d2eb71ee53eee3d11:1

value
10379292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31da74bc26950b1b70fb16a61ac51140f9df5cf9 OP_EQUAL
address
36EcjXpNsyix9WeiwgycumXS2A7GAPkEWv
transaction
d5953fc9adae9411bc6937e4542ca1b661fff65420c5468d2eb71ee53eee3d11
spent
true